Savor the Sunshine: Garlic Herb Shrimp Corn Boil Delight

A delicious Garlic Herb Shrimp Corn Boil that combines tender shrimp and sweet corn with aromatic flavors.

  • Total Time: 25 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 pound large shrimp, peeled and deveined
  • 4 ears of corn, husked and cut into thirds
  • 1/4 cup olive oil
  • 5 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 tablespoons fresh parsley, chopped
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Optional: red pepper flakes for a spicy kick

Instructions

  1. Prepare ingredients: peel and devein shrimp, cut corn into thirds.
  2. Boil water, add corn, and cook for 5-7 minutes until tender; set aside.
  3. In the same pot, heat olive oil and sauté garlic for 1 minute.
  4. Add shrimp, seasoning with salt, pepper, and paprika; cook for 3-5 minutes until pink.
  5. Return corn to pot, add lemon juice and parsley, and toss to mix.
  6. Serve hot, garnished with extra parsley if desired.

Notes

  • Adjust seasoning to taste.
  • For extra spice, add red pepper flakes.
